A few of the common services include:
Lock Installation: Whether you're moving into a new home or updating your security, a locksmith can assist you choose and set up the best locks.
Lock Repair: If you have a malfunctioning lock, a locksmith can diagnose the problem and repair it, which may save you the cost of a replacement.
Rekeying: This service includes changing the inner functions of a lock so that a new key is needed to operate it. It's a cost-effective service when you lose your secrets or wish to prevent previous tenants or owners from accessing your home.
Emergency Services: Many locksmith professionals provide emergency services for lockouts, lost keys, or urgent repair work. They can react quickly to restore your security.
Security Assessment: A professional locksmith can carry out a comprehensive assessment of your home's security and advise enhancements, such as much better locks or a complete security system upgrade.
Master Key Systems: For bigger homes or properties with numerous locks, a locksmith can develop a master key system that streamlines access while maintaining security.

Here's a list of key considerations:
Licensing and Insurance: Always check if the locksmith is accredited and guaranteed. This safeguards you in case of any damages or mishaps throughout the service.
Experience and Reputation: Look for locksmith professionals with a strong reputation and a great track record. Online reviews and recommendations from good friends or household can assist in this regard.
Schedule: Ensure the locksmith provides services that fit your schedule, specifically if you require emergency services.
Transparent Pricing: A reliable locksmith needs to provide clear estimates before beginning any work, avoiding concealed charges.
Service warranty: Inquire about service warranties on parts and labor. An excellent locksmith will back up their work.
While employing a locksmith, it assists to be mindful. Here are some safety tips:
Do Your Research: Before you need a locksmith, research and compile a list of potential candidates. In this manner, you will not feel rushed into a decision in an emergency.
Request Identification: When the locksmith shows up, ask for identification and organization cards. This assists ensure that you're handling a legitimate professional.
Get a Written Estimate: Before any work starts, constantly request a composed estimate detailing the expenses included.
Check Background: If possible, examine the locksmith's background or request recommendations to verify their reliability.
1. How much does a locksmith normally charge?
Locksmith costs can differ commonly depending upon the service needed, area, and time of service (e.g., after-hours charges). Usually, anticipate to pay between ₤ 50 to ₤ 150 for standard services, with emergency services possibly costing more.
2. Can a locksmith unlock any door?
The majority of professional locksmiths can unlock a variety of door types, consisting of residential, industrial, and automotive doors. However, particular high-security locks may need customized devices and competence.
3. What should I carry out in a lockout scenario?
If you find yourself locked out of your home, the initial step is to stay calm. Contact a professional locksmith who uses emergency services, and consider examining if you have a spare key with a trusted neighbor or relative.
4. How typically should learn more alter my locks?
It's advisable to change your locks whenever you move into a new home or if you feel your security has been jeopardized. Frequently reassessing your home's security is likewise a good practice.
5. Are locksmith services offered 24/7?
Many locksmiths provide 24/7 emergency services, however it's essential to confirm this in advance. Always choose a locksmith who ensures you of assistance in immediate circumstances.
